The main difference between planar magnetic and dynamic headphones is how the speaker diaphragm is moved to produce sound. While dynamic headphones utilize cone- or dome-shaped diaphragms, planar magnetic headphones use extremely thin membranes that are printed with conductors. Conductors react with magnets on one or both sides to manipulate the diaphragm to produce sound waves. This enables the planar drivers to move more quickly and to a greater range of frequencies than the dynamic type.

Due to the unique way in which they create sound they have greater transparency and clarity than other models. They are also less susceptible to distortion from harmonics. They're not as easy than the typical headphones to drive, which is the reason audiophiles use them in conjunction with an amp for their headphone.
